Church Lane is in Kingston, Cambridge and in South Cambridgeshire district. CB23 2NG is located in the Caldecote electoral ward, within the English Parliamentary constituency of South Cambridgeshire. This postcode has been in use since 2006-09-01.

Safety

Is Church Lane Street dangerous?

Over the last 12 months, the overall crime rate around Church Lane was 114.2 per 1,000 residents, which is 146.6% higher than the Barrington average. The most reported crime type was Violence and sexual offences.

Church Lane has the 3rd highest crime rate of 51 local areas in Barrington and the 50th highest crime rate of 498 local areas in South Cambridgeshire .

Violent and sexual offences accounted for around 47.2 crimes per 1,000 residents and have been rising year on year. Over the last decade, overall crime has fallen by about -37.7%.

Employment

CB23 2NG area has a very high level of entrepreneurship. Only 7% of streets have higher percent of entrepreneur residents. 16% of population in this area is self-employed, while the average in the UK is 9.7%. High number of entrepreneurs usually leads to relatively high economic growth, higher paid jobs and better quality of life in the area.

CB23 2NG area has a low unemployment rate. According to Census 2021, 3% residents of this area were unemployed, while the average in the UK was 4.83%. A low level of unemployment in an area indicates a strong job market, where most people who are seeking work can find employment. This generally reflects a healthy economy in the area.
